New York: 'Fuel Gemach' • Due to darkness: outbreak of theft and accidents

The severe shortage of fuel all over New York continues, and residents go to New Jersey to get the black gold • Many neighborhoods are still in a state of darkness

Fuel shortage across New York, endless queues still trailing around various fuel stations in Borough Park and Flatbush, and many residents have to travel a distance of three quarters of an hour to New Jersey to refuel their cars, some even filling containers of extra fuel besides for the vehicle tank.

Around the fuel shortage has also emerged the phenomenon of special 'charity', students and business people who live in Brooklyn and work in New Jersey, but come regularly by subway, volunteer to take someone's car instead of another person in need for fuel and fill the tank.

The 'Chaveirim' organization in Borough Park opened a fuel Gemach last Friday. Anyone who needs fuel can call the number 718-431-8181 and get information about the state and the gas distribution centers. For a deposit of $100, any person in need can get a can containing five gallons of fuel. The organization requests that anyone who lends fuel should try and return it that same day.

Due to domestic fuel crisis, Dov Hikind, Assemblyman of New York called, a press conference on Friday, calling for Mayor Michael Bloomberg to resign, due to the failed function days after the storm, Sandy.

As part of his failure Hikind noted that ten days after the storm, thousands of families in Lakewood, Far Rockaway and Seagate are still in the dark without electricity, and without the ability to heat their homes in the freezing weather which prevails in New York.

Even in the town of Monsey the power returned only this Friday, and this, only after massive lobbying by Orthodox residents activists.

Last night (Motzei Shabbos) two buses full of Orthodox Jews from Baltimore went to Seagate to help and assist the residents to rebuild their homes, clean and sort the Sifrei Torah, the holy books and the synagogues which were damaged in the storm.

Meanwhile, during the past few days the 'Shomrim' and 'Chaveirim' organizations reinforced their forces and patrols in the dark neighborhoods, because of the increase in cases of robbery and theft in the dark areas. Criminals are taking advantage of the fact that the security cameras do not work, and under cover of darkness they steal everything in sight.

Another negative result due to the darkness: traffic accidents significantly increased especially in the evening.
